Here's my good news! I replaced the water reservoir in the hatcher with one that had more surface area and it shot right up to 70%!

 

Also, I candled my latest test batch of my ducks' eggs and 11 out of 12 are developing. Hooray for the drakes who are doing their jobs!!! celebrate.gif

Well, 3 ducklings hatched (helped one a little when it hadn't gone from pip to zip in over 24 hours).  But the other 3 were fully developed but no internal pipping and clearly deceased upon opening.  What would you more experience hatchers suggest for problems?  I started some in a homemade bator until day 10 then I sorted down to the 6 fertile (out of 12 set) and then the rest of the time they were in a brinsea mini advanced.  I did open and spritz them once daily until lock down when I filled full reservoir and spritzed well.  Any suggestions appreciated. caf.gif  (Note: not sure DH is pushing for bigger hatches, lol hence how I talked him in to my brinsea.  See honey, it only hatches 7.  He wasn't really fooled but I of course want 7 of 7 to hatch)
